Types of States and Capitals Worksheets PDFs



Matching Worksheets


Students match states to their correct capitals, reinforcing recognition and recall.

Labeling Maps


Printouts of blank U.S. maps where students fill in the names of states and capitals.

Multiple Choice Quizzes


Questions with several options for each, testing knowledge and understanding.

Fill-in-the-Blank Activities


Sentences or lists with missing words where students supply the correct state or capital.

Coloring and Fun Activities


Color maps or state flags that help students associate colors with states and their capitals.

Flashcards and Memory Games


Printable flashcards with state names on one side and capitals on the other for self-testing.

How to Use States and Capitals PDFs Effectively



Creating a Study Routine


Set aside regular times during the week for worksheet practice. Consistency helps reinforce memory.

Combining Worksheets with Interactive Activities


Use digital quizzes, flashcards, or online games alongside PDF worksheets to diversify learning methods.

Involving Multiple Senses


Encourage students to say the names aloud while coloring or writing to enhance retention.

Assessing Progress


Periodically review completed worksheets to identify areas needing more practice.

Tips for Teachers and Parents



- Start with easier matching or labeling activities before progressing to more challenging quizzes.
- Use worksheets as a supplement, not a replacement, for hands-on map activities.
- Encourage students to create their own quizzes or flashcards based on worksheet content.
- Incorporate rewards or recognition to motivate consistent practice.
- Adapt worksheets for different age groups by adjusting difficulty levels.
